Chip card
The chip card stores the addresses of the slaves. All programming operations are
stored both in the module and on the chip card.
•
The device can operate both with and without a chip card.
•
If a blank chip card is plugged into a programmed module, the configuration
of the module is stored on the chip card.
•
If a non-blank chip card is plugged into an non-programmed module, the con-
figuration of the chip card is transmitted to the module. The changes do not
become effective until the module is restarted.
•
If a non-blank chip card is plugged into a different programmed module, the
configurations do not agree and an error message is displayed.

AS-i Power 24
•
internal decoupling network / AS-i voltage is generated out of 24 V
ext
directly
•
no external AS-i power supply, no external decoupling unit required!
•
maximum 0,5 A for AS-i available using internal decoupling network
•
switching between internal and external decoupling.
